Today is International Women's Day, which means there's no better day to appreciate the women around you. The theme of this year's International Women's Day is to "make it happen," to demand greater equality between men and women. This inspired us to not waste any time to tell the women we see every day why they make us better. So today, be sure to #TellHer!

International Women's Day has been around since 1977 when the United Nation's officially marked March 8th as the day to celebrate women's rights and international peace. This year, the UN has called for the public to "empower women and empower humanity," which the International Women's Day movement has called to action with their theme "make it happen."
